Regional Context

The WBG serves 30 client countries in the Latin America andthe Caribbean Region (LCR). Clients range from large rapidly
growing sophisticated middle-income clients to IDA countriesto small Caribbean states to one fragile state. Despite
immense resources, dynamic societies, and an average annualper capita income of about $4,000, deep inequalities persist
in most LCR countries, with nearly a quarter of the Region'speople living in poverty. The last Bank's strategy for LCR
focused on three pillars: (a) supporting the foundations forinclusive growth; (b) investing in human capital and protecting
the poor; and (c) building resilience. In the aftermath ofthe COVID19 pandemic, this strategy will need to be adjusted to
better support the countries deal with a health crisiswithout precedents and an economic crisis not seen since modern
statistical records started in 1900. Yet, the basic elementsof the strategy: accelerating growth (following a projected GDP
contraction in 2020 of 7.2%), investing in human capital,including in health (in the most affected region by COVID19), and
building resilience are fully relevant.

Unit Context

The Operations Services Unit (LCROS) plays an important rolein advising the Regional Vice President and supporting LCR's
management and operational team to ensure the highestquality of its operational deliveries. LCROS offers high quality
inputs across key stages of strategy formulation andprogram/project preparation and implementation; embeds the
WBG's twin goals and LCR's regional priorities intooperations and outputs; and helps the Region deliver impactful
strategies and projects to its client countries. LCROS'swork program ranges from Pipeline Delivery Management; Quality
Assurance; Portfolio management and monitoring, ResultsMeasurement and Management; Regional Risk Management;
support on Regional and Corporate priorities; andOperational Learning and Knowledge Sharing targeted to regional staff.
It houses the Secretariat of the Regional OperationsCommittee and includes the team of the Regional Environmental and
Social Standards Advisor (RSA).
